The average train between Baltimore and Boardwalk Hall takes 3h 16m and the fastest train takes 2h 48m. There is a train service every few hours from Baltimore to Boardwalk Hall.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run every 2 hours between Baltimore and Boardwalk Hall. The earliest departure is at 5:58 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Baltimore is at 10:51 PM which arrives into Boardwalk Hall at 2:24 AM. All services require a transfer at 30th Street Station and take an average of 3h 16m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Baltimore to Boardwalk Hall. However, there are services departing from Baltimore station and arriving at Boardwalk Hall station via 30th Street Station station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 16m.
Baltimore to Boardwalk Hall train services, operated by Amtrak Acela, depart from Baltimore Penn Station.
Baltimore to Boardwalk Hall train services, operated by Amtrak Acela, arrive at Atlantic City Rail Terminal station.
The distance between Baltimore and Boardwalk Hall is 187.1 km. The road distance is 261 km.
You can take a train from Baltimore Penn Station to Boardwalk Hall via 30th Street Station and Atlantic City Rail Terminal in around 4h.
